1. Overview of Carbon Steel Silos
Carbon steel silos are upright structures designed for the storage of bulk materials. Their composition primarily consists of carbon steel, which provides durability and resistance to environmental factors. These silos are typically equipped with advanced features, such as temperature control, moisture management, and automated loading systems, making them highly efficient storage solutions.
2. Applications in Agriculture
Agricultural industries have long relied on carbon steel silos for the efficient storage of grain and feed. Here are a few innovative applications in this sector:
2.1. Grain Storage and Preservation
Large carbon steel silos are ideal for storing grains, such as wheat, corn, and barley, due to their ability to maintain optimal conditions for preservation. With controlled ventilation systems, these silos help prevent spoilage and protect the stored grains from pests.
2.2. Feed Storage for Livestock
Farmers can effectively store animal feed in carbon steel silos, ensuring that livestock has a consistent supply of nutrition. The airtight design of these silos prevents the feed from absorbing moisture and degrading, thus maintaining its nutritional value.
3. Industrial Uses of Silos
Beyond agriculture, large carbon steel silos find extensive applications in various industrial settings. Here are some sectors that benefit from their use:
3.1. Cement and Building Materials
In the construction industry, carbon steel silos are essential for storing cement and other bulk materials. Their strength and stability allow for the safe storage of these materials, facilitating efficient transportation and mixing processes.
3.2. Chemical and Petrochemical Industries
Chemical manufacturers utilize carbon steel silos for storing bulk chemicals safely. The design of these silos ensures that hazardous materials are contained securely, minimizing the risk of spills and contamination.

5. Innovations in Design and Technology
Recent advancements in design and technology have further increased the efficiency of carbon steel silos:
5.1. Smart Silo Technology
The integration of IoT devices allows for real-time monitoring of silo conditions. Sensors can track temperature, humidity, and inventory levels, providing valuable data that enhances operational decision-making.
5.2. Modular Designs
Modular carbon steel silos offer flexibility in storage solutions. Industries can easily scale their storage capacity by adding or removing silo modules based on their needs, optimizing both space and resources.
